Abstract

The present invention comprises a filler material for a container having at least one compartment, which container is situated in a pressurized beverage container and, immediately after the beverage container is opened, is suitable for mixing the filling into the drinks liquid surrounding the container. The filling itself is in granule form of defined particle diameter and is composed, in particular, of the main component a) in the form of a food supplement and an effervescent component b). The component a) which should be present in the filling in amounts of between 35 and 98% by weight can also be pharmaceutical active ingredients, vitamins, creatine derivatives, phospholipids, probiotics, minerals, unsaturated fatty acids and any desired mixtures thereof. The fillings can be introduced into drinks liquids of varying pH, since, because of its solubility and due to the targeted selection of suitable effervescent and disintegrant components, can be rapidly and completely dissolved or suspended in the drinks liquid.

Claims

exact text as granted — not AI-modified
1 - 22 . (canceled)  
   
   
       23 . A filler material for a container having at least one compartment, wherein the container is situated in a pressurized beverage container and wherein immediately after the beverage container is opened, is suitable for mixing the filler material into the beverage liquid surrounding the container, wherein the filler material is in granule form and has an average particle diameter of 1.0 to 7.0 mm.  
   
   
       24 . The filler material according to  claim 23 , wherein said average particle diameter is between 1.5 and 6.0 mm.  
   
   
       25 . The filler material according to  claim 23 , wherein said granules are in a form selected from the group consisting of spherical, flake, rodshaped, polygonal, unsymmetrical, amorphous form or a mixtures thereof.  
   
   
       26 . The filler material according to  claim 23 , wherein the filler material comprises fines in the form of a particle fraction having an average diameter of <1.0 mm in an amount of at most 20% by weight, based on the total amount of the filling.  
   
   
       27 . The filler material according to  claim 23 , comprising an active component a) and an auxiliary component b).  
   
   
       28 . The filler material according to  claim 27 , wherein active component a) is selected from the group consisting of a food supplement, a pharmaceutically active ingredient, a vitamin, a phospholipid, a probiotic, a mineral, an unsaturated fatty acid, an amino acid, a phytosterol and a polysaccharide, a derivate thereof of a mixture thereof.  
   
   
       29 . The filler material according to  claim 27 , wherein the active component a) is selected from the group consisting of acetylsalicylic acid, a representative of the vitamin groups A, B, C, D, E and K, riboflavin, folic acid, creatine monohydrate, creatine pyruvate, creatine/citric acid compounds, in particular creatine citrate, glucosamine, chondroitin, phosphatidylserine, phosphatidylcholine, phosphatidylethanolamine, phosphatidylinositol, docosahexaenoic acid (DHA), eicosapentaenoic acid (EPA), conjugated linoleic acid (CLA) and arachidonic acid (ARA) and also the minerals calcium, magnesium, manganese and zinc.  
   
   
       30 . The filler material according to  claim 27 , wherein the auxiliary component b) is an effervescent component.  
   
   
       31 . The filler material according to  claim 27 , wherein the effervescent component is selected from the group consisting of a carbonate salt, a hydrogen carbonate salt, an organic acid, a disintegrant and a crosslinker.  
   
   
       32 . The filler material according to  claim 23 , wherein the active component a) is present in an amount of from 35 to 98% by weight and the auxiliary component b) is present in an amount of from 2 to 65% by weight.  
   
   
       33 . The filler material according to  claim 23 , wherein said auxiliary component b) is an aid for dissolving the active component a) in the drinks liquid.  
   
   
       34 . The filler material according to  claim 33 , wherein said auxiliary component b) is a disintegrant.  
   
   
       35 . The filler material according to  claim 23 , wherein the component b) is a formulation aid selected from the group consisting of a bulking agent, a release agent, a flavour substance, a coloring and a sweetener.  
   
   
       36 . The filler material according to  claim 23 , wherein the granules contain at least one of an active component a) or an auxiliary component b).  
   
   
       37 . The filler material according to  claim 23 , it contains the granules in core-shell form, in particular the active component a) forming the core and the auxiliary component b) forming the shell.  
   
   
       38 . The filler material of  claim 37 , wherein the active component a) is contained in the core, and auxiliary component b) is contained in the shell.  
   
   
       39 . The filler material according to  claim 23 , suitable for introducing into beverage liquids which have a pH<7.0.  
   
   
       40 . The filler material according to  claim 23 , suitable for introduction into beverage liquids which have a pH≧7.0.  
   
   
       41 . The filler material according to  claim 23  wherein at a temperature of from 4 to 20° C., the filler material has a suspension time in the drinks liquid of 10 to 300 seconds.  
   
   
       42 . The filler material according to  claim 23 , wherein the granules were produced by mechanical or chemical grain enlargement compression pelleting or pelletizing under the action of a compression force between 1 and 20 kN/cm.  
   
   
       43 . The filler material according to  claim 23 , comprising an active component a) in an instant form.  
   
   
       44 . The filler material according to  claim 23  wherein the drink liquid is a refreshment drink.  
   
   
       45 . The filler material according to  claim 23 , suitable for a refreshment drink, a soft drink, a fruit juice-containing drink, a milk-based drink, a beer and an alcoholic mixed drink.  
   
   
       46 . The filler material according to  claim 23 , suitable for a drink tin whose drinks liquid has an overpressure compared with the compartment container of ≧0.3 bar.  
   
   
       47 . The filler material of  claim 24 , wherein the average particle diameter is between 2.0 and 5.0 mm.  
   
   
       48 . The filler material of  claim 26 , wherein said fines are present in an amount of up to 15% by weight.  
   
   
       49 . The filler material of  claim 24 , wherein said fines are present in an amount of up to 10% by weight.  
   
   
       50 . The filler material according to  claim 28 , wherein said active component a) is selected from the group consisting of cellulose, creatine, α-lipoic acid and dietary fiber.  
   
   
       51 . The filler material according to  claim 27 , wherein said effervescent component is selected from the group consisting of citric acid, phosphoric acid, malic acid, tartaric acid, carboxymethylcellulose, alginic acid, a low-substituted hydroxypropylmethylellulose, a starch glycolate and a crosslinked N-vinyl-2-pyrrolidone.  
   
   
       52 . The filler material according to  claim 34 , wherein the distintergrant is present in an amount of less than or equal to 10% by weight.  
   
   
       53 . A beverage container comprising: 
 a first container having at least one compartment having a pressure therein and having an opening; and    a beverage in said container; wherein    said compartment contains the filler material of  claim 23.
